Resin VS Block Paving

Charlie Clark • June 20, 2024

When investing in a brand-new driveway surface, choosing the best material is extremely important to achieve a long-lasting finish, as well as increasing the aesthetic appeal of your home. Resin and block pave driveways are two very popular options, both with their own advantages and disadvantages. Throughout this blog post, we will discuss which one will offer you the best driveway outcome

Durability & Longevity

Resin driveways are notorious for their longevity and durability, typically lasting 15 to 20 years, with minimal maintenance. Block paving driveways are known to shift and crack overtime, making resin the most durable alternative.

Adaptability & Customisation

If you're looking to add a personal touch to your driveway, resin is a perfect option due to their customisation flexibility. Resin driveways offer a number of colours, finishes and even patterns, allowing you to create a unified look, matching your driveway to the rest of your home. Block paving driveways offer fewer design alternatives, making it far less flexible

Low Maintenance

Resin driveways are a practical option for busy homeowners, because of their amazing durability, they require far less maintenance than block paving for example. For homeowners investing in a resin driveway, we will always suggest occasional sweeping and jet washing in order to maintain its appearance. On the other hand, block paving driveways require a bit more upkeep, as they need to be re-sealed on a regular basis. 

Sustainability

Resin driveways are a perfect option for environmentally conscious homeowners. Due to resin being a porous material, it allows water to seep through the surface, reducing the risk of run-off and flooding. Block paving is an impermeable surface, therefore you are at a greater risk of a flooded driveway.

To conclude, in the majority of cases, resin driveways tend to be the best option for homeowners looking for a safe, durable and aesthetically pleasing driveway. Resin driveways are an affordable and long-lasting investment for your home, also increasing the resale value.
